Mowing & Maintaining

Once your new lawn has taken hold , the real work of ongoing upkeep begins. Trimming is, of course, a core part of this, but it's far more than just a routine chore. Aim to shear your grass at the recommended height for its species, typically around 2.5 to 3 inches. Maintaining your blades is also crucial for a clean cut and healthy growth. Beyond consistently mowing, remember fertilizing your grass a few times throughout the growing period and addressing any unwanted plants promptly. Proper watering is also fundamental ; deep, infrequent watering are usually better than shallow, frequent ones. Finally, aerating your lawn periodically can improve soil ventilation , leading to a more robust and stunning landscape.
